New York Jets cornerback Antonio Cromartie was in attendance at practice on Thursday, but he was without pads and did not participate in position drills due to a sprained knee.

Cromartie has said that he won't return until he is 100-percent healthy, citing his decision to play through injury in 2013. At this point, it would be a surprise to see Cromartie on the field against the Indianapolis Colts on Monday night.

Fortunately, the Jets have depth at cornerback and should be able to overcome Cromartie's absence. And the fact that Cromartie will return this season at all is a huge bonus after the injury was initially thought to be a torn ACL.
